Delhi Metro and IIT Hyderabad’s TiHAN Sign MoU to Drive Autonomous Navigation for Smarter Last-Mile Mobility

Delhi Metro and IIT Hyderabad’s TiHAN Sign MoU to Drive Autonomous Navigation for Smarter Last-Mile Mobility

The Delhi Metro Rail Corporation (DMRC) has recently signed a Memorandum of Understanding (MoU) with the Technology Innovation Hub for Autonomous Navigation (TiHAN) at IIT Hyderabad. This collaboration aims to explore innovative technologies that will enhance autonomous navigation systems, ultimately leading to safer and smarter mobility solutions in urban environments.

Objectives of the Partnership

The primary objective of this partnership is to improve last-mile connectivity in major metropolitan areas. Many commuters face challenges in traveling from metro stations to their final destinations, and this initiative seeks to address those issues. Furthermore, the project will investigate how similar technological solutions can be applied to smaller Tier II and Tier III cities, where public transport infrastructure is still developing. The integration of modern technology has the potential to significantly enhance mobility in these regions.

Strengths of the Collaborating Entities

Both DMRC and TiHAN bring unique strengths to this collaboration:

  • TiHAN: Specializes in autonomous navigation technologies, including systems that enable vehicles, robots, and drones to operate independently without human intervention.
  • DMRC: Offers extensive expertise in urban transit operations, passenger mobility, and the various challenges encountered in real-world transportation systems.

By leveraging these strengths, the partnership aims to develop and test autonomous platforms that can operate independently while collecting valuable data to improve public transport services.

Research and Development Initiatives

The MoU marks the commencement of joint research, trials, and innovation between DMRC and TiHAN. This collaboration is expected to pave the way for the development of new technologies, including:

  • Autonomous shuttle services
  • Intelligent mobility devices
  • Data-driven planning enhancements

The formal signing of the MoU was conducted by Shobhan Chaudhuri, Advisor for Research and Development at DMRC, and Dr. Santosh Reddy, the Hub Executive Officer at TiHAN, IIT Hyderabad.

Broader Context of Autonomous Navigation in India

The collaboration between DMRC and TiHAN is part of a broader trend in India towards embracing autonomous technologies in transportation. Various cities across the country are exploring the implementation of driverless trains, autonomous buses, and other intelligent transport solutions.

For instance, Bengaluru has recently launched driverless trains on its Airport Blue and Pink Lines, showcasing the potential of autonomous systems in enhancing public transport efficiency. Similarly, other metro systems, such as those in Mumbai and Chennai, are also investing in advanced technologies to improve their services.
